What is a condensed matter system?
Condensed matter systems exposed to radiation may have very different natures, being inorganic, organic or biological, finite or infinite, be composed of many different molecular species or materials, existing in different phases (solid, liquid, gaseous or plasma) and operating under different thermodynamic conditions.

Why should we study Attosecond Dynamics in condensed matter physics?
Entering the Fundamental Physics. The exploration on attosecond dynamics is uniquely positioned to provide new scientific insights on fundamental physics problems, such as the dynamic mechanism of quasiparticle formation and phase transition in condensed matter physics.
What is an example of ultrafast condensed matter physics?
Before the emergence of ultrafast condensed matter physics, the attosecond dynamics in atoms and molecules has gained wide attention.[56–61] For example, the pioneer-ing work by Calegari et al. figured out the ultrafast charge migration in the phenylalanine with a sub-4.5-fs oscillation after prompt ionization.
